Staff Embedded Software Engineer

Stryker

Irvine, CA, US
$118,000 - $196,600; bonus eligible; benefits py
Onsite
Embedded c/c++ development
Software engineering for medical devices
Cross-functional collaboration
The Staff Software Engineer supports and leads project teams in the development of embedded software for medical device products

Job Summary

  • The Staff Software Engineer supports and leads project teams in the development of embedded software for medical device products.
  • Independently research, design, develop, and verify complex mechanical and electro-mechanical components for next-generation vascular thrombectomy platforms.
  • Collaborate cross-functionally with R&D, Quality, Manufacturing, Regulatory, and Clinical teams to ensure design excellence and project success.

Matching Summary

The Staff Software Engineer supports and leads project teams in the development of embedded software for medical device products.

Salary

$118,000 - $196,600; Bonus eligible; Benefits

Skills & Requirements

Must-have

  • Embedded C/C++ development
  • Software engineering for medical devices
  • Cross-functional collaboration
  • System integration
  • Prototype development and testing

Nice-to-have

  • Data-driven analysis
  • Continuous improvement initiatives
  • Mentoring peers
  • Artificial intelligence
  • Real-time analytics

Key Requirements

  • Bachelor's degree in Computer Science, Computer Engineering or related discipline
  • 4+ years of work experience
  • Embedded C/C++ experience
  • Experience with IEC 62304/62366
  • Experience with ISO 13485/14971
  • Software development for Class II and Class III medical devices

Work Rights

Not specified

Tailored Resume

Cover Letter